I · Overview

W8 runs from Kensington Gardens to Holland Park: white stucco villas, brick townhouse terraces, garden squares, and along Kensington Palace Gardens some of the most valuable houses in the world.

Ownership here is measured in decades. Houses are family seats rather than trading assets, which means the sales that matter are generational: estates, probate, and long-held houses coming to the market unmodernised after thirty or forty years.

II · Why investors target W8

Estate and probate sales. Generational ownership produces executor-led sales where certainty and discretion outrank price.

The unmodernised discount. The gap between renovated and unrenovated sold prices on the same street routinely exceeds the cost of the works — a measurable, provable margin.

Freehold scarcity. Whole-house freeholds within walking distance of two royal parks are a fixed-supply asset with a permanent international buyer pool.

IV · Market commentary

W8’s most reliable inefficiency is condition. When a house held for forty years reaches the market, its price is set against renovated neighbours with a discount that usually overshoots the real cost of refurbishment — because retail buyers price disruption, not works. For a buyer who can price the works accurately, the unmodernised estate sale is the closest thing Prime Central London offers to a structural, repeatable margin.

V · Questions

What buyers ask about Kensington & Holland Park

Why do W8 houses come to market so rarely?

Kensington houses are held as family homes, often across generations, and the freehold supply is fixed. Sales are triggered by life events rather than market timing, which keeps volumes low in every cycle.

What is the opportunity in unmodernised Kensington stock?

An unmodernised house typically sells at a discount to the street’s renovated evidence that exceeds the actual cost of the works. Buyers who can price refurbishment professionally capture that spread — and estate sellers value their certainty enough to widen it further.

Does W8 include Kensington Palace Gardens?

Yes — the tree-lined avenue between Notting Hill Gate and Kensington High Street sits within W8 and is among the most expensive residential addresses in the world. Its pricing anchors W8’s international standing and its evidence base at the very top end.
